All games should be random for them to be fair. A scam casino will rip off their games and/or alter them in such a way that they’re given the advantage (on top of the advantage these games already give casinos).

A scam casino may also tweak their free practice games to favorit players to encourage them to play the lesser “fair” paid games.

We all play to have fun, but we also play to win money. A shady casino will take weeks, months or even years to pay players back, either because they don’t have the cash flow -which is scary- or because they want to encourage the player to continue playing or to take a bonus so that they won’t cash out. Both are rogue behavior. But when a casino leaves you hanging and the check never shows up in the mail? That’s not cool. Not all bad online casinos that are blacklisted lie about sending you money. In fact, most don’t. Instead, they’ll tell you straight up that you don’t qualify for a withdrawal because you violated certain bonus conditions or didn’t meet the deposit requirements.

One of the sneakiest things rogue casinos do is change their terms on the fly, on an as-needed basis. They’ll do this when they’re in dispute with a player over something they say the player’s done wrong, but hasn’t really. They’ll change the terms to support their argument. Yet, when you look at the archives you can see the terms were recently changed from siding with the player …to siding with the casino.

What Defines a Blacklisted Casino?

At LegitGamblingSites.com, our team of reviewers checks every casino thoroughly for signs of a rogue operator. Here are some of the red flags that we look for when we are reviewing any online casino.

Payment Issues

The most common complaint from online casino players is that a casino is taking forever to send them their withdrawal or they aren’t paying them at all. It usually all goes the same way; a casino says the withdrawal can take up to 30 days to process, then excuses start about why the payment is delayed. Following that, either a partial payment is paid, or the money never shows up. Online casino players are savvy; many are used to these tricks and use public forums to call out the operators. However, the rogue casinos don’t care and will continue to steal money right from their loyal players.

Licensing

Legitimate casinos tend to get licensed by a jurisdiction that gives players the security in knowing that the owners have been properly vetted and that their money is going to be safe. As with everything else in this industry, there are ways to get around this; some countries provide “licenses” that have far less stringent rules if any at all. In extreme cases, a rogue casino will slap a logo from one of these regulatory boards on their site without ever having gone through the application process.

Pirated Software

This one can be a little tricky to detect without an expert checking into it. Basically, an operator hacks the software to stop it from being controlled by the software vendor. This gives them the opportunity to use the software without paying for it, as well as being able to change the paytable configuration to whatever they want. A genuinely shady way to do business, you find these operators usually hiding out in Russian and the Ukraine.

“Too Good To Be True” Offers

We’ve all seen them: Deposit Bonuses of 300%, 400%, even 1,000%. So attractive e from the outside, but so unrealistic when it comes to actually clearing the bonus. Add in some brutal Terms and Conditions, and there is no chance you are able to cash out winnings from these offers. Many rogue casinos use these flashy types of promotions to bait you into joining their site; we are here to tell you that if an offer looks too good to be true, then it probably is. Stick to more manageable numbers when it comes to deposit bonuses.
